About the wine
The Lion’’s Vat is a blend created by Diego Sandrin. Starting in 2008, the Venetian collector and founder of Lion’’s Whisky poured a little of each whisky he tasted into two small casks, before transferring them into two Venetian wine casks (Raboso and Fragolino) previously used to finish Laphroaig 10 Year Old Cask Strength. After five years’’ maturation in these casks, the blend was bottled for a charitable organization that helps underprivileged children play sport. A limited edition of just 40 bottles, it contains over 500 whiskies, including some iconic bottlings such as Bowmore 1966 Bouquet and the Laphroaig 1967 bottle by Samaroli.
